Investment Analysis

Oneok has made significant strides in expanding its operations through multiple acquisitions. The latest transactions not only boost its scale but are also expected to improve its financial profile. These actions could have several implications for stock prices.

Free Cash Flow (FCF)

Oneok's acquisitions are anticipated to be accretive to its free cash flow, with projections suggesting an average increase of more than 20% per share through 2027. This increase in free cash flow can lead to higher valuations as investors often view growing cash flows as a positive signal. Additionally, expect this to enable more aggressive capital allocation, potentially boosting Oneok's share price.

Dividend Yield

The expectation to increase dividends by 3% to 4% per year further augments Oneok's attractiveness to income-seeking investors. A consistent and growing dividend could generate more demand for the stock, positively impacting its price.

EBITDA Growth

Oneok's projection of generating over $8 billion in adjusted EBITDA next year—more than double its figures from a few years ago—signifies strong operational performance. Such growth in EBITDA can enhance the company’s value perception in the market, leading to increased investments.
